Why 60,000 Women Left Tech and What Emotional Intelligence Has To Do With It 11.12.2025 31:04
Send us Fan Mail Last year, 60,000 women left the UK tech industry costing an estimated £3.5 billion. They didn’t just leave because of childcare or confidence. They left mainly because of culture, leadership, and a total lack of clear progression.
